Ruaridh's journey so far
Ruaridh joined Answer Digital through the Test Automation Academy in Autumn 2023. After graduating, he worked with a finance client, guiding their test function on various internal projects. His role has involved hands-on testing, teaching the client's testers the right approach, and delivering theoretical training sessions on software testing.
